So all of these are arm64_cpu_capabilities, i.e, cpu_errata, ELF_HWCAPS and cpu_hwcaps. Each of them have a matches() routine, which without this series, checks if the system as a whole has the capability. Now the matches() could use its own checks using system wide values (read_system_reg(), used by everything except cpu_errata) or CPU register values(right now, all of them use MIDR). The tables are processed by a common routine, update_cpu_capabilities(). The cpu_errata table is processed for each booting CPU, while the cpu_hwcaps is processed only once, after all the CPUs have booted. SCOPE is really a hint to the matches() to tell us the capability of the entire system (SCOPE_SYSTEM) vs that of a single CPU(SCOPE_LOCAL). This is needed, because matches() may do more than checking the feature register values (e.g, has_useable_gicv3_cpuif() ), which makes it difficult to the check if a given CPU has a capability. So we initialise the system capabilities by passing SCOPE_SYSTEM to the matches() from update_cpu_capabilities(). And we use SCOPE_LOCAL when we do the early verification check for CPUs that turn online after the system initialised the bits or this_cpu_has_cap() introduced in this series.
